Java里用Jedis操作Redis时,管道(Pipeline)是怎么提升批量删除效率的?
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
Python内容推荐
波士顿房价预测实战:SVM回归模型Python完整实现与可视化
直接可用的SVM回归预测代码包,基于scikit-learn实现,专为波士顿房屋数据集定制。包含训练与测试两套Excel数据文件(boston_housing_train_data.xlsx、boston_housing_test_data.xlsx),运行svm.py即可自动完成数据加载、SVM模型拟合、房价中位数预测,并输出训练集和测试集的均方误差(MSE)数值结果。配套生成两张Matplotlib图表:Figure_1.png展示实际值与预测值的散点对比,直观反映拟合效果;Figure_2.png以双曲线形式并列呈现真实房价走势与模型预测走势,便于趋势判断。代码结构清晰,无额外依赖,适配主流Python环境,注释明确,支持快速复现与教学演示。README.md提供简明运行指引,开箱即用,无需调试即可验证SVM在经典回归任务中的表现。
Python处理NCDC气象数据[代码]
本文详细介绍了如何使用Python处理NCDC的ISD-Lite气象数据,从FTP下载到Excel可视化的全流程。内容包括环境准备与数据获取、解析ISD-Lite固定宽度格式、数据清洗与质量控制、分析与可视化输出、自动化流水线构建以及高级分析与扩展。通过具体的代码示例,展示了如何下载气象数据、解析固定宽度格式、进行数据清洗和质量控制,并将结果输出到Excel和可视化图表中。此外,还介绍了如何构建自动化流水线以及进行更深入的气候分析,如热浪检测和气候指标计算。
Jedis操作redis服务实例
此外,对于日志记录,`systemlog`可能是指在使用Jedis操作Redis时,记录系统日志或Redis操作日志。通常,我们可以利用Java的日志框架(如Log4j、SLF4J等)记录关键操作,以便于调试和监控系统的运行状态。 总之,...
Java项目中使用Jedis 操作 Redis 的示例
这是基于 Java 技术栈,借助 Jedis 客户端操作 Redis 数据库的实践项目示例。内含连接 Redis、执行增删改查(如 String 类型赋值取值、List 类型 push/pop 等)、事务与 pipeline 等常用操作的代码 。适用 Java 开发...
jedisRedis的Java客户端
Jedis是Redis的Java客户端,它提供了一个丰富的API来操作Redis数据存储系统。Redis是一个高性能的键值数据库,常用于缓存、消息中间件以及数据结构服务器等场景。Jedis作为Java开发者与Redis交互的主要工具,使得在...
Java中使用Jedis操作Redis的实现代码
- `jedis.pipeline()`:开启管道,提高批量操作的效率。 对于Redis集群环境,Jedis也提供了支持。在集群模式下,可以通过`JedisCluster`类进行操作,需要提供集群节点的配置信息。集群操作与单机版本类似,但需要...
Java使用Jedis操作Redis服务器的实例代码
本篇文章主要介绍了Java使用Jedis操作Redis服务器的实例代码,包括Maven配置、简单应用、JedisPool的实现和使用pipeline批量操作等。 在 Java 项目中,需要使用 Redis 实现缓存机制时,需要使用 Jedis 库来操作 ...
Redis的Java客户端Jedis
在2018年6月10日,Jedis的最新版本为2.9.0,这个版本包含了对Redis各种操作的支持,并且优化了性能,提升了稳定性。 1. **Jedis的基本使用** - **连接Redis服务器**:Jedis通过`Jedis jedis = new Jedis(...
完整的java操作redis demo
在这个“完整的java操作redis demo”中,我们不仅可以看到如何使用Jedis进行基本的Redis操作,还能学习到如何结合Java处理Excel数据,这在数据导入导出或者数据分析场景中非常实用。 首先,我们要了解Jedis的基本...
Java客户端利用Jedis操作redis缓存示例代码
此外,Jedis还支持列表(List)、集合(Set)、有序集合(Sorted Set)的操作,以及事务处理、管道(Pipeline)等功能。通过这些功能,开发者可以在Java应用中充分利用Redis作为缓存系统,提高数据读取效率,减轻数据库压力...
jedis-2.9.0 最新版Redis客户端CSDN下载
Jedis是Java语言中使用最广泛的Redis客户端库,它提供了丰富的API来操作Redis服务器。在这个"jedis-2.9.0"的最新版本中,我们包含了三个重要的文件: 1. `jedis-2.9.0.jar`:这是Jedis的二进制发行版,包含了所有...
Redis集群模式下Jedis批量操作优化方案
使用JedisCluster.pipeline()创建管道,Jedis会自动将命令路由到正确节点,但需注意: 不支持跨slot事务 需保证key的hash tag一致(如{user}:1001和{user}:1002) 第三方库支持 推荐使用Lettuce客户端(Spring Boot...
详解redis大幅性能提升之使用管道(PipeLine)和批量(Batch)操作
本文将深入探讨如何利用Redis的管道(PipeLine)和批量(Batch)操作来显著提高数据处理速度。 首先,让我们回顾一下问题的来源。在示例代码中,为了记录商品购买用户,使用了`SADD`命令向Redis的Set中添加元素。...
redis3.0+jedis
4. **Pipeline and Multiplexing**: 通过管道和复用连接,提高了批量命令发送的效率,减少了网络延迟。 5. **Connection Pooling**: 提供连接池管理,便于在多线程环境中高效地重用连接,减少资源消耗。 6. **...
java操作redis数据库实例
Jedis还支持更多高级功能,如Pipeline(批量操作)、Lua脚本执行等,可以根据具体需求进一步学习和使用。 请根据实际情况调整代码中的IP地址、端口号、键名、值等信息,确保与你的Redis服务器配置匹配。同时,为了...
java调用redis工具类jedis
Java调用Redis工具类Jedis是Java开发人员在与Redis进行数据交互时常用的库。Redis是一个高性能的键值存储系统,常被用作数据库、缓存和消息中间件。Jedis是Java语言的一个轻量级Redis客户端,它提供了丰富的API来...
java开发环境使用redisjar包
同时,Jedis也支持事务、管道(Pipeline)和脚本(Lua Scripting),这些特性可以帮助优化批量操作的性能。 总的来说,通过Jedis这个Java客户端,开发者可以方便地在Java应用中集成和利用Redis的强大功能,提升应用...
redis集群java客户端,支持批量提交
java客户端不是很好支持redis cluster,spring-date-redis和jedis批量提交还不支持,单个提交都是可以的。 为了批量解决批量提交 网上有几个方案,本示例使用了其中一种,demo里的JedisClusterPipeline类是网上找的...
java操作redis所需jar
Jedis库还提供了更多高级特性和方法,如连接池管理、Pipeline批量操作等,可以根据实际需求进一步学习和使用。了解并熟练掌握这些内容,将有助于你在Java应用中高效地利用Redis来处理数据存储和缓存问题。
jedis-2.9.0.jar Java中连接redis所需的jar包
标题中的“jedis-2.9.0.jar”是指Jedis的一个特定版本,它是Java语言中用于连接和操作Redis数据库的客户端库。Jedis是开源的,由Pascal Lesier开发,它提供了丰富的API,使得Java开发者能够方便地在应用程序中集成...
最新推荐



